对于大小核,“CPU相关性”绑定后要比不绑定好,这可能是如果调度小核,会导致大核等待小核结果。
然后,昨天突发奇想,win11下用vmware安装了虚拟机ubuntu server,跑出来的结果也是非常惊人。以下记录了“CPU相关性”绑定的结果。
代码很简单,一段512次的随机累加,一段是2^18x2^18稀疏矩阵构建,一段调用eig,没别的了。
win11下,8核的加速比是3.88;
win11下的vm中,8核的加速比是5.48;
双路2680中,8核时加速比是6.90。
【 在 dareta 的大作中提到: 】
: 那还不是os的锅吗?
: 发自「今日水木 on iPhoneProPlusMax」
--
FROM 124.160.88.*